Jet Black iPhone 7/7 Plus Now Available in 32GB, Starting at $739
Apple previously only offered Jet Black iPhone 7 and iPhone 7 Plus models in 128GB or 256GB options, but that has changed with the announcement of iPhone 8, iPhone 8 Plus and iPhone X.
Following price drops across the entire older generation iPhone line up, Apple now only offers 32GB and 128GB options, and this now means highly sought after Jet Black models are now available at a lower storage tier—and price.
Previously, customers had to pay more for the premium colours, which were more difficult to manufacture and also a sign to friends and family you had the latest and greatest.
A 32GB iPhone 7 in Jet Black starts at $739 CAD, whereas last year customers had to pay at least $1029 for 128GB—a difference of $290, if they wanted the rare colour option.

A 32GB iPhone 7 Plus in Jet Black starts at $899 CAD now, whereas last year users had to pay at least $1179 for the 128GB model, a difference of $280.
These models are showing as delivering in 5-7 business days.
